S83.103S
ICD-10-CMThis code indicates a partial dislocation of the knee joint where the specific bone involved (e.g., patella, tibia, femur) is not documented, and the laterality (left or right) is also unknown. It signifies that the subluxation is a long-term consequence or complication of an earlier injury or condition, rather than an acute event.
This code is appropriate when a patient presents with ongoing symptoms related to a previously occurring, but unspecified, knee subluxation, and the medical record lacks details regarding the specific anatomical site or side. It should be used when the subluxation is no longer acute and is being treated as a chronic or residual problem.
